begin process at 2010 02 10 07:14:45
  Trouver un code source :
 
dans
 
Accueil > Forum > 

SQL

 > 

SQL Server, MSDE, SQL Express

 > 

Procédures Stockées

 > 

Jointure


Derniers messages déposésPoser une question dans le forum ou lancer une discussion

Jointure

jeudi 30 novembre 2006 à 17:20:48 | Jointure

issoux


Bonjour voilà mon probleme

j'ai 3 tables  :


table role :

id (clé primaire)
nom

table UserRole
id,( clé primaire )
RoleId ( clé etrangere de role)
UserId (clé etrangere de personne)

table personne
id ( clé primaire)
nom
prenom


Je voudrais créer une requete qui m'affiche que les rôles que l'utilisateur a ....

Dans mon appli , j'ai 5 roles different

utilisateur 1 est admin, viewer et helpdesk
utilisateur 2 est helpdesk seulement


J'ai besoin d'une requete qui selectionne juste les noms des roles que le user a

Merci à vous

lundi 4 décembre 2006 à 16:32:57 | Re : Jointure

Fianchetto

Réponse acceptée !
SELECT [table role].nom
FROM [table role], [table UserRole], [table personne]
WHERE [table role].role = [table UserRole].RoleId AND
              [table personne].id = [table UserRole].UserId AND
              [table personne].nom = "Utilisateur recherché par nom"

bref, rien de bien transcendant...


Cette discussion est classée dans : table, clé, role, primaire, jointure


Répondre à ce message

Sujets en rapport avec ce message

update table à 2 clé primaire [ par adnanester ] salutvoila , j'ai une table à deux clé primaire, et pour mettre a jour une ligne de cette table je fait le requete suivante a partir de l'analyseur de Jointure table clé composé [ par didygwatinik ] Bonjour, Je me pose une question quand je veux faire une jointure, est-il préférable de la faire sur la clé primaire de la table ?Si j'ai une table av Ajout d'une clé primaire avec des doublons [ par jourdanne85 ] Bonjour à tous, Voilà mon problème. Je dois récupérer une table DM_CONSULTATION_PLAINTE (SQL Server Express). Cette table représente en fait les plai Clé primaire , clé étrangère [ par emmanuel9 ] Bonjour à tous, "Aieuuuuuuu" m'a dit hier que une table n'avais pas besoin de contenir une clée primaire J'ai oublier de lui demander  : Si ma tabl pitié aidez moi avan ce soir! SQL-ACCESS/UPDATE [ par tchoukette ] J'ai un gros problème pour une requete UPDATEJ'exporte une table B dans ma base de données.Ma table met à jour ma table AIl s'agit de produits composé SELECT sur une table avec clé étrangère en boucle sur une table [ par Sieurcoug ] Bonjour,Je vous expose mon souci qui va vous paraître simple (vu mon niveau en SQL ;)) :Voilà, j'ai besoin de lister les enregistrements de la table S Recherche sur table de jointure [ par MereDenis ] Bonjour.Premier post sur un forum après plusieurs tentatives de recherches infructueuses mais surement maladroites donc milles excuses si la questions Jointure sur 3 tables [ par djagger ] Bonjour,je galère depuis quelques temps sur une requete de jointure.Voici un exemple vite fait :- une table VOITURE (id ,  immatriculation)- une table Correction de Trigger [ par 4rocky4 ] Bonjour tout le monde,Je voudrai créer des triggers qui permettent de mettre à jour des tables sous Oracle.Par exemple, si on modifie la clef primaire


Nos sponsors


Sondage...

Comparez les prix

CalendriCode

Février 2010
LMMJVSD
1234567
891011121314
15161718192021
22232425262728

Consulter la suite du CalendriCode

 
Développement réalisé par Nicolas SOREL (Nix) avec l'aide de : Cyril DURAND et Emmanuel (EBArtSoft), Merci à Vincent pour ses précieux conseils.
CodeS-SourceS.com© Toute reproduction même partielle est interdite sauf accord écrit du Webmaster
CodeS-SourceS.com© est une marque déposée tous droits réservés

Google Coop CodeS-SourceS Google Coop CodeS-SourceS
Temps d'éxécution de la page : 0,328 sec (3)

Nous contacter | Annoncer sur CodeS-SourceS | Mentions légales